首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WPF控件名称" Fluent :RibbonWindow“中的前缀Fluent表示什么?

在WPF控件名称"Fluent:RibbonWindow"中,前缀"Fluent"表示一种界面设计风格,即Fluent Design System。Fluent Design System是由微软推出的一种现代化、直观且具有吸引力的用户界面设计语言。它旨在提供一致的用户体验,使应用程序在不同设备和平台上都能够呈现出高质量的外观和交互效果。

Fluent Design System的特点包括:

  1. 深度:通过使用光影、层次和透明度等效果,为界面元素增加深度感,使用户能够更好地理解和导航应用程序。
  2. 动态:引入动画和过渡效果,使界面元素的变化更加平滑和自然,提升用户的交互体验。
  3. 颜色:采用鲜明的颜色和渐变效果,使界面更加生动、丰富,并提供更好的可视化反馈。
  4. 材料:借鉴了物理世界中的材料属性,如纸张、玻璃和墨水等,为界面元素赋予更加真实的质感。

Fluent Design System适用于各种类型的应用程序,包括桌面应用程序、移动应用程序和Web应用程序。它可以提升用户界面的美观度和易用性,使应用程序更具吸引力和竞争力。

腾讯云提供了一系列与界面设计相关的产品和服务,例如腾讯云UI设计解决方案、腾讯云移动应用开发平台等,可以帮助开发者实现符合Fluent Design System的界面设计。具体产品和服务的介绍和链接地址可以参考腾讯云官方网站的相关页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用WindowChrome自定义RibbonWindow

什么要自定义RibbonWindow 自定义Window有可能是设计或功能上要求,可以是非必要,而自定义RibbonWindow则不一样: 如果程序使用了自定义样式Window,为了统一外观需要把...在最大化时候标题栏内容甚至超出屏幕范围。 WPF提供Ribbon是个很古老很古老控件,附带RibbonWindow也十分古老。...以前做法通常是使用Fluent.Ribbon之类第三方组件,因为我已经在Kino.Toolkit.Wpf中提供了使用WindowChrome自定义Window,为了统一外观于是顺手自定义一个ExtendedRibbonWindow...结语 我也见过一些很专业软件没处理RibbonWindow,反正外观上问题忍一忍就过去了,实在受不了可以买一个有现代化风格控件库,只是为了标题栏对不齐这种小事比较难说服上面同意引入一个新组件。...除了使用我提供解决方案,stackoverflow也由不少关于这个问题讨论及解决方案可供参考,例如这个: c# - WPF RibbonWindow + Ribbon = Title outside

1.1K30

流畅设计 Fluent Design System 光照效果 RevealBrush,WPF 也能模拟实现啦!

流畅设计 Fluent Design System 光照效果 RevealBrush,WPF 也能模拟实现啦!...然而古老 WPF 项目也想解解馋怎么办? 于是我动手实现了一个! ---- 迫不及待看效果 ? ▲ 是不是很像 UWP RevealBorderBrush?...▲ 我自己画图,不忍直视,只好模糊掉作为背景了 话不多说看源码 UWP 里 CompositionBrush 是用一个 ShaderEffect 做出所有控件所有效果。...正如 叛逆者 在 如何评价微软在 Build 2017 上提出 Fluent Design System? - 知乎 一文,只需要极少计算量就能完成。...WPF 不让我们实现自己 Brush,所以只好用 MarkupExtension 绕道实现了。

81720

用 Effect 实现线条光影效果

在实现过程我用到这些知识和技巧: Segoe Fluent 图标字体 在 Blend 创建 Path 计算 Path 长途 Path 边框动画 VisualStudio 设计时数据支持 自定义...应用,在 XAML 输入下面这段 XAML: <TextBlock FontFamily="Segoe <em>Fluent</em> Icons" Text="" Foreground="#C72335...设计时数据是你设置<em>的</em>模拟数据,使<em>控件</em>更易于在 XAML 设计器中进行可视化。d: <em>前缀</em>用于设置设计时<em>的</em>属性值,它只影响设计视图,不会编译到正在运行<em>的</em>应用<em>中</em>。...自定义 Effect 在 <em>WPF</em> <em>中</em>要做发光效果通常都是用 DropShadowEffect ,例如这样: <...我不知道这种效果叫<em>什么</em>名字,但因为它最终实现了发光<em>的</em>效果,所以命名为 GlowEffect。

1.4K10

如何使用Fluent Design System (下)

不得不再次点名批评改名部,看看以前Lumia、Aero、Metro、Modern,个个都好读好记;Fluent Design System什么鬼。...文章开头介绍视频展示了ParallaxView在MR运行效果,效果有趣很多: ? 即使只在桌面上运行,FDS也激发了不少创意。例如这些设计: ?...其实比起各种新控件新特效,我更希望FDS给出一个大设计准则,一个严谨又包容多样性规范。这几年随着Windows不再强势,设计师好像突然就忘了在桌面上怎么设计了。...当年也曾热衷于在桌面上使用Metro,但现在对在WPF上使用FDS没什么兴趣。何况这个主题是讨论UWP额FDS,不太想涉及WPF。...上一篇文章评论里提到FDS其中几种元素在WPF实现,有兴趣可以参考一下。 8.

1.2K20

WPF工具开发: 第三库选择

库, 风格不可定制 WPF Property Grid 开源 功能还不够完善 可以定制风格 PropertyEditor for WPF 开源 功能比较实用, 有自己特色 Actipro PropertyGrid...商业控件 Mindscape WPF Property Grid 商业控件 DockWindow AvalonDock 开源, 几乎是商用之外最好选择 DotNetBar for WPF...商业控件库 Actipro Docking & MDI 商业控件库 RibbonBar Microsoft Ribbon for WPF 官方扩展 功能单一 Fluent Ribbon Control...Suite 开源 支持Office2010风格 DotNetBar for WPF 商业控件库 很方便VS内嵌设计器 最新版支持Office2010风格 除了RibbonBar, 还有其它很实用功能...Simple WPF Syntax Highlight Textbox ScintillaNET 这是Scintilla.Net封装, 很有名一个控件 Actipro SyntaxEditor 这个是收费

1.1K50

WPF 很少人知道科技

本文介绍不那么常见 WPF 相关知识。 ---- 在 C# 代码创建 DataTemplate 大多数时候我们只需要在 XAML 中就可以实现我们想要各种界面效果。...,以便在 WPF 界面的同一个列表显示多个数据源数据。...例如,我曾经用 WPF 来模拟 UWP 流畅设计(Fluent Design)光照效果,使用附加属性来管理此行为则完全不用担心内存泄漏问题: 流畅设计 Fluent Design System 光照效果...UWP 标题栏按钮 模拟 Fluent Design 特效 目前 WPF 还不能直接使用 Windows 10 Fluent Design 特效。...当然如果你程序非常小,那么模拟一下也不会伤害太多性能: 流畅设计 Fluent Design System 光照效果 RevealBrush,WPF 也能模拟实现啦!

25620

winform能做出漂亮界面吗_winform界面美化第三方控件

大家好,我是架构君,一个会写代码吟诗架构师。今天说一说winform能做出漂亮界面吗_winform界面美化第三方控件,希望能够帮助大家进步!!!... CheckBox.CheckState 属性,SetBinding 方法 Lambda 表达式是转换属性值转换器。...(l) l.Text, Function(x) x.Price, "Price: {0:C2}") 将多个属性绑定到同一个控件 要在同一控件组合多个属性值,请使用 MvvmContext.SetMultiBinding...此方法接受以下参数: 控件名称; 应该绑定控件属性; 一个字符串数组,填充了可绑定 ViewModel 属性名称,这些属性值应该组合在一起; 一个格式字符串(对于不可编辑控件)或一对转换器(如果允许用户编辑绑定控件...使用格式字符串模块将属性绑定到禁用(不可编辑)编辑器,在使用转换器模块,您可以更改 TextEdit 值并将更新后字符串传递回 ViewModel 属性。

3.2K20

使用 Microsoft.UI.Xaml 解决 UWP 控件和对老版本 Windows 10 兼容性问题

即提供各种 Windows UI 功能向后兼容性,包括 UWP XAML 控件Fluent 流畅设计样式和画刷。当然,不支持亚克力效果系统版本虽然画刷能用,不崩溃,但也没有效果。 ?...,比如我在 StackOverflow 上回答问题 Use ResourceDictionary with other Styles in WPF 也是这样改法,其中说明了必须这样修改原因。...不过没有结束,在需要使用到新版本 Windows 10 控件 XAML 文件,需要添加命名空间前缀: xmlns:controls="using:Microsoft.UI.Xaml.Controls..." 这样才能在 XAML 中使用 Microsoft.UI.Xaml 库控件: <controls:NavigationView x:Name="WalterlvDemoView...当然除了在 XAML <em>中</em>,也可以在 C# 代码中使用库<em>中</em><em>的</em>新 API。 解决意料之外<em>的</em>错误 一切可以那么顺利?

3.3K10

基于.NET平台常用框架整理

持续更新 自从学习.NET以来,优雅编程风格,极度简单可扩展性,足够强大开发工具,极小学习曲线,让我对这个平台产生了浓厚兴趣,在工作和学习也积累了一些开源组件,就目前想到先整理于此,如果再想到...ExposedObject:在类外部通过动态语言dynamic方式访问私有成员。 PrivateObject:微软单元测试框架便捷在外部调用类内部私有成员一个类。...桌面应用程序框架 DevExpress:一个全球知名桌面应用程序UI控件库。...开源图表统计控件: Visifire:一套效果非常好WPF图表控件,支持3D绘制、曲线、折线、扇形、环形和梯形。...SparrowToolkit:一套WPF图表控件集,支持绘制动态曲线,可绘制示波器、CPU使用率和波形。DynamicDataDisplay:微软开源WPF动态曲线图,线图、气泡图和热力图。

3K20

如何编写 WPF 标记扩展 MarkupExtension,即便在 ControlTemplateDataTemplate 也能生效

如何编写 WPF 标记扩展 MarkupExtension,即便在 ControlTemplate/DataTemplate 也能生效 发布于 2018-05-29...只要赋值那个属性接受 Brush 类型,就不会出错。 然而……有小伙伴写了更加复杂标记扩展,在标记扩展还通过 serviceProvider 拿到了目标控件一些属性。...,XAML 标记扩展也是立即执行,这就意味着当标记扩展 ProvideValue 执行时,还没有根据模板创建控件呢,那创建什么呢?...是一个名为 System.Windows.SharedDp 对象,不明白是什么?没关系,微软把这个类设置为 internal 了,就是不想让你明白。...:流畅设计 Fluent Design System 光照效果 RevealBrush,WPF 也能模拟实现啦!。

1.5K10

盘点7个开源WPF控件

盘点7个WPF控件,有窗口托拉拽控件、Excel控件、列表排序控件、适合管理系统一整套UI控件等。...1、一个可拖拉实现列表排序WPF开源控件 项目简介 gong-wpf-dragdrop是一个开源.NET项目,用于在WPF应用程序实现拖放功能,可以让开发人员快速、简单实现拖放操作功能。...2、一个类似Office用户界面的WPF库 项目简介 Fluent.Ribbon是一个开源UI库,它提供了现代化、易于使用用户界面,可以用于创建各种类型桌面应用程序。...3、一套包含16个WPF控件套件 项目简介 这是基于WPF开发,为开发人员提供了一组方便使用自定义组件,并提供了各种常用示例。...4、可托拉拽WPF选项卡控件,强大好用! 项目简介 这是一个基于WPF开发,可扩展、高度可定制、轻量级UI组件,支持拖拉拽功能,可以让开发人员快速实现需要选项卡窗口系统。

88420
领券